Linking Excel Tables to SQL Server Pro: Best Practices

Introduction to Linking Excel Tables to SQL Server Pro

Ovfrview of Excel and SQL Server Integration

The integration of Excel tables with SQL Server Pro offers a powerful solution for financial professionals seeking to manage and analyze data efficiently. By linking these two platforms, users can leverage Excel’s user-friendly interface alongside SQL Server’s robust database capabilities. This synergy allows for seamless data manipulation and reporting, which is crucial in the fast-paced financial sector. Data-driven decisions are essential for success.

Linking Excel to SQL Server enables users to import large datasets directly into a structured database environment. This process minimizes the risk of errors that often occur during manual data entry. Financial analysts can focus on interpreting data rather than managing it. Accuracy is paramount in finance.

Moreover, the ability to automate data updates from Excel to SQL Server enhances operational efficiency. Users can set up scheduled tasks that ensure their databases reflect the most current information. This feature is particularly beneficial for organizations that rely on real-time data for decision-making. Timeliness is key in financial markets.

In addition, SQL Server’s advanced querying capabilities allow for complex data analysis that goes beyond Excel’s limitations. Financial professionals can execute sophisticated queries to extract insights that drive strategic initiatives. Insightful analysis leads to informed decisions.

Overall, the integration of Excel and SQL Server Pro represents a strategic advantage for financial professionals. It streamlines workflows and enhances data integrity, ultimately supporting better financial outcomes. Embracing technology is essential for growth.

Importance of Best Practices in Data Management

Effective data management is crucial for organizations that rely on accurate financial reporting and analysis. Best practices in this area ensure that data remains consistent, reliable, and accessible. For instance, when linking Excel tables to SQL Server Pro, adhering to established protocols can significantly enhance data integrity. This is vital for making informed financial decisions. Data integrity is non-negotiable.

To illustrate, consider the following best practices:

  • Data Validation: Implement checks to ensure data accuracy before importing it into SQL Server. This reduces errors and discrepancies. Errors can be costly.

  • Consistent Formatting: Maintain uniform data formats across Excel and SQL Server. This simplifies data integration and analysis. Consistency is key.

  • Regular Backups: Schedule routine backups of both Excel files and SQL Server databases. This protects against data loss. Data loss can disrupt operations.

  • Access Control: Limit access to sensitive financial data to authorized personnel only. This enhances security and compliance. Security is paramount.

  • Documentation: Keep detailed records of data sources, transformations, and processes. This aids in audits and troubleshooting. Documentation saves time.

  • By following these practices, financial professionals can ensure that their data management processes are robust and effective. This leads to more accurate financial forecasting and reporting. Accurate forecasts drive strategic planning.

    In summary, the importance of best practices in data management cannot be overstated. They form the foundation for reliable financial analysis and decision-making. Reliable data is the backbone of finance.

    Preparing Your Excel Data for Import

    Cleaning and Formatting Excel Tables

    Cleaning and formatting Excel tables is a critical step in preparing data for import into SQL Server. This process ensures that the data is accurate, consistent, and ready for analysis. First, it is essential to remove any duplicate entries that may skew results. Duplicate data can lead to misleading conclusions.

    Next, users should standardize data formats across all columns. For instance, dates should be in a consistent format, such as YYYY-MM-DD, to facilitate proper sorting and querying. Consistency in formatting enhances data integrity. Additionally, financial figures should be formatted as numbers, ensuring that calculations can be performed without errors. Accurate formatting is crucial for financial analysis.

    Moreover, it is important to eliminate any unnecessary whitespace or special characters that could interfere with data processing. This includes trimming spaces from the beginning and end of text entries. Clean data is easier to work with. Users should also ensure that all relevant columns are labeled clearly, as this aids in understanding the data structure. Clear labels improve communication.

    Finally, conducting a thorough review of the data before import can help identify any remaining issues. This review should include checking for missing values and ensuring that all necessary data points are present. Missing data can compromise analysis. By following these steps, financial professionals can prepare their Excel data effectively, setting the stage for successful integration with SQL Server. Prepared data leads to better insights.

    Ensuring Data Consistency and Accuracy

    Ensuring data consistency and accuracy is vital when preparing Excel data for import into SQL Server. This process begins with a thorough examination of the data entries. Identifying discrepancies, such as variations in naming conventions or numerical formats, is essential. Consistent data reduces confusion.

    Furthermore, users should implement validation rules within Excel to enforce data integrity. For example, setting specific criteria for numerical fields can prevent erroneous entries. This proactive approach minimizes the risk of inaccuracies. Accurate data is crucial for reliable analysis.

    In addition, it is important to cross-check data against trusted sources. This verification process helps confirm that the information is correct and up-to-date. Regular audits of the data can also identify any inconsistencies that may arise over time. Regular checks are a best practice.

    Moreover, utilizing Excel’s built-in tools, such as conditional formatting, can highlight anomalies in the data. This visual aid allows users to quickly spot and address issues. Quick identification leads to faster resolutions. By maintaining a focus on data consistency and accuracy, financial professionals can ensure that their analyses are based on reliable information. Reliable data drives informed decisions.

    Methods for Importing Excel Tables into SQL Server Pro

    Using SQL Server Import and Export Wizard

    Using the SQL Server Import and Export Wizard is an effective method for importing Excel tables into SQL Server Pro. This tool provides a user-friendly interface that simplifies the data transfer process. By guiding users through each step, it minimizes the potential for errors. A streamlined process is essential for efficiency.

    Initially, users must select the data source, which in this case is the Excel file. It is crucial to ensure that the file is properly formatted and accessible. Accessibility is key for successful imports. After selecting the source, the wizard prompts users to choose the destination database within SQL Server. This step is vital for organizing data effectively. Proper organization aids in data management.

    Once the source and destination are established, users can map the Excel columns to the corresponding SQL Server fields. This mapping ensures that data is accurately transferred to the correct locations. Accurate mapping prevents data misalignment. Additionally, the wizard allows users to preview the information before finalizing the import. This preview feature is beneficial for identifying any discrepancies. Quick checks save time.

    Finally, users can execute the import process, and the wizard will provide feedback on the success of the operation. Monitoring the import results is important for confirming that all data has been accurately transferred. Successful imports lead to reliable data analysis. By utilizing the SQL Server Import and Export Wizard, financial professionals can efficiently manage their data integration tasks. Efficient management enhances productivity.

    Utilizing SQL Server Integration Services (SSIS)

    Utilizing SQL Server Integration Services (SSIS) provides a robust method for importing Excel tables into SQL Server Pro. This powerful tool allows users to create complex data workflows that can automate the import process. Automation saves time and reduces manual errors. He can design data flows that include transformations, ensuring that the data is in the correct format before it reaches the destination.

    To begin, he must create an SSIS package using SQL Server Data Tools. This package serves as a blueprint for the data import process. A well-structured package enhances efficiency. Within the package, he can define data sources, including the Excel file, and specify the destination database. Clear definitions are essential for successful execution.

    Moreover, SSIS allows for data transformations during the import process. For instance, he can convert data types or aggregate values as needed. Transformations ensure data accuracy. Additionally, SSIS provides error handling capabilities, enabling users to manage any issues that arise during the import. Effective error management is crucial for maintaining data integrity.

    Finally, once the package is configured, he can execute it to perform the import. SSIS offers logging features that track the process and provide insights into performance. Monitoring results is important for continuous improvement. By leveraging SSIS, financial professionals can streamline their data import processes, leading to more efficient data management. Efficient management is vital for success.

    Best Practices for Maintaining Linked Data

    Regular Updates and Data Synchronization

    Regular updates and data synchronization are essential for maintaining linked data in financial systems. He must ensure that the data remains current and accurate to support effective decision-making. Accurate data is crucial for analysis. To achieve this, he can implement several best practices.

    First, establishing a schedule for regular updates is vital. This schedule should align with the frequency of data changes in the source systems. Consistency is key for reliability. For example, he might choose to update data daily, weekly, or monthly, depending on the business needs. Timely updates enhance data relevance.

    Second, utilizing automated tools for data synchronization can significantly reduce manual effort. These tools can facilitate real-time data updates, ensuring that linked data reflects the most current information. Automation minimizes errors. He can also set up alerts to notify him of any synchronization issues. Quick notifications allow for prompt resolutions.

    Third, conducting periodic audits of the linked data is important. These audits help identify discrepancies and ensure that the data remains aligned across systems. He should document any changes made during these audits for future reference. Documentation aids in transparency.

    Finally, training staff on the importance of data accuracy and synchronization can foster a culture of accountability. Educated employees are more likely to adhere to best practices. Knowledge is power. By implementing these strategies, he can maintain the integrity of linked data, ultimately supporting better financial outcomes. Better data leads to better decisions.

    Monitoring and Troubleshooting Common Issues

    Monitoring and troubleshooting common issues is essential for maintaining linked data effectively. He must regularly review data synchronisation processes to identify any discrepancies. Regular reviews prevent larger issues. Common problems include data mismatches, missing entries, and connectivity issues. Identifying these problems early is crucial for data integrity.

    To facilitate monitoring, he can implement automated alerts that notify him of any synchronization failures. These alerts can be configured to trigger based on specific criteria, such as time delays or data inconsistencies. Quick notifications enable prompt action. Additionally, maintaining detailed logs of data transactions can help trace the source of issues. Logs provide valuable insights.

    When troubleshooting, he should first verify the data sources to ensure they are functioning correctly. This includes checking for any changes in the source data structure that may affect the import process. Understanding the source is vital. If discrepancies are found, he can compare the linked data against the original source to pinpoint errors. Comparison is an effective strategy.

    Furthermore, conducting root cause analysis on recurring issues can help prevent future occurrences. By identifying underlying problems, he can implement corrective measures. Prevention is better than cure. Training staff on common issues and their resolutions can also enhance overall data management. Knowledge empowers the team. By adopting these practices, he can ensure that linked data remains accurate and reliable, supporting informed decision-making. Reliable data drives success.

    Comments

    Leave a Reply

    Your email address will not be published. Required fields are marked *